A series of mononuclear complexes and unsymmetric dinuclear alkynylplatinum(II)terpyridine complexes with oligo(paraphenylene ethynylene)(OPE)-derived backbone with a variation of the lengths of alkoxy chains and OPE backbones was synthesized.The morphological properties,packing lattice and gelation behaviors of the mononuclear complexes were systematically studied,and the thermodynamic parameters and packing lattices of the dinuclear complexes were also investigated,providing further insights into the roles of the non-covalent interactions and their delicate balance in constructing sophisticated supramolecular architectures.Metallogel and nanotube formation have been observed upon a delicate control of the intermolecular interactions by altering the lengths and structural dimensions of the complexes.
